Following the passage of the 19th Amendment, changes in property laws significantly improved women's lives by allowing women to obtain personal property after marriage. This means that women gained greater financial independence and legal rights regarding their own belongings, which was a crucial step toward achieving gender equality. These legal reforms helped to dismantle the traditional views that considered women as dependents of their husbands in terms of property ownership and management.
